Closed Karvaporsas closed 3 years ago
Jaahas, näyttää että ollaan taas Lambdan kantokyvyn rajoilla. Katotaas.
Voin tod näk paikata väliaikaisesti muuttamalla noiden id:iden luomistapaa (jotta datan määrä vähenee), mutta tämä endpoint alkaa olla lambda-tiensä päässä. Hajoaakohan ihmisten systeemit jos muutan noiden tartuntojen id:itä?
Taustalla siis se että lambdalla joka ton datan parsii ja jakaa on 6 megan raja (AWS:n rajoitus) siinä mitä se pystyy läpi puskemaan ja sen rajan yli on nyt tässä menty.
Todennäköisesti hajoaa.
Mitä jos rajapinta tarjoaisi sairaanhoitopiireittäin datan finnishCoronaData/v2/HUS jne
Tai ottaisi parametrina montako päivää taaksepäin palautetaan dataa?
Mahdollista. Ei toki auta suoraan niitä jotka on jo integroitunu tohon rajapintaan.
Periaatteessa olisi kaikkien paras käyttää noita paremmin muotoiltuja rajapintoja:
Tartunnat: https://w3qa5ydb4l.execute-api.eu-west-1.amazonaws.com/prod/processedThlData Sairaala + kuolemat: https://w3qa5ydb4l.execute-api.eu-west-1.amazonaws.com/prod/finnishCoronaHospitalData
Katotaan mitä tälle tehdään, olen nyt kiinni muissa töissä mutta palaan asiaan.
@Karvaporsas katoppas josko toimisi. Siirsin sisällön paketoinnin lambdan sisään (sen sijaan että se gzipattaisiin API GW:ssä).
Lukeminen onnistui. Kiitoksia. :)
Rajapinta
https://w3qa5ydb4l.execute-api.eu-west-1.amazonaws.com/prod/finnishCoronaData/v2
palauttaa virhettä kutsuttaessa.